Price
The good stuff are not over yet though, as this is a very affordable dual cab, no doubt about
that. The manual starts at just shy of $50.000, while you can get the auto for around $52.000.
That's less than most of the competition, namely the Toyota Hilux or the VW Amarok.
Features
This special edition of the Ranger comes with all the standard equipment, but there are some
extra goodies at your disposal. By going for the SE you'll also get a sports bar, tow bar, side
steps, tailgate liner, auto headlights and a reverse camera.
That's a lot of extras added to an already formidable list of features...
